Transaction e870e264bf75dc4e91f40ad4740649c960755952ec5410d898682c9a72a14a64
1 Input
1 Output
-
e870e264bf75dc4e91f40ad4740649c960755952ec5410d898682c9a72a14a64:0
- value
- 44634
- script pubkey
- OP_0 OP_PUSHBYTES_20 cba161ac58619256ea3eb978d4777b942f4a0b75
- address
- bc1qewskrtzcvxf9d637h9udgammjsh55zm4m64333